Adding a new opening balance
ljjanes
I just got Quicken yesterday. When I went to add my CC info it would only go back 88 days I would like to start at the beginning of the year how do I do this. Credit card company starts on 4/24 so I have 12/24 1/24 2/24 and 3/24 statements that I would like to enter and reconcile.
1. Do I just enter everything manually - not an issue I know how to do this
2. How do I make a starting balance when i already have one entered by my automatic download?
3. I tried changing the date of the 4/24 and then adjusting the opening balance but it willl let me change the date but not the opening balance?

Chris_QPW
#1 It might be possible to import more transactions if your financial institution allows you to export your older transactions using a Quicken Web Connect .QFX file. You would download the file and open it in your web browser or Windows File Explorer and it should import into Quicken or use this menu:
File -> File Import -> Web Connect (.QFX) File...
On #2 and #3 you should be able to change both the date and the amount of the opening balance transaction (and this is how you would do this). It will warn you that you are entering a transaction back into the same account, but in this case that is exactly what you want. Note that you aren't changing the Balance column, you are changing the Charge column.

Mark1104
1) yes, just enter everything manually
2) the beginning balance is goin going to be a forced number - whatever number is required to make the ending balance (as of the date of the last download) correct
q_lurker
Your 12/24 statement may also give you the 'right' opening balance value to plug in, if you are trying to enter all transactions including payments after the prior statement.
The recommendation is that payments to the card from your checking account be treated as transfers from the checking to the CC account. If you use that approach in entering these prior payment transactions you may need to be watching your checking account transactions and editing accordingly.
